    Paul. It could only have been Paul.

    Paul did not include his name in the salutation simply because it was being written "To the Hebrews" and they considered him a traitor. They would not have bothered to read it if they knew he wrote it.

    It had to be Paul due to 10:34, "For you had compassion of me in my bonds, and took joyfully the spoiling of your goods, knowing in yourselves that you have in heaven a better and an enduring substance."

    Who else in the New Testament spent a lot of time in prison and the people sold their goods to give sacrificially to support him during that time?
